自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

missdeer 之程序的野望

倚楼听风雨,淡看江湖路——未来的不可知,是我们前进的原动力!花开,然后花落,星光闪耀,不知何时熄灭。这个地球,太阳,银河系,甚至整个宇宙也总会有消失的时候,人的生命和那些相比只不过是一瞬间吧,在那一瞬间中,人诞生,微笑,哭泣,战斗,伤害,喜悦,悲伤,憎恨谁

  • 博客(13)
  • 资源 (4)
  • 收藏
  • 关注

原创 上学期学微机原理课,写的一个判断质数的程序-_-b

整理硬盘的时候发现的,最多可以判断64bits的数,觉得就这样d了有点对不起当时自己的努力了-_-b .486data segment use16buf db 30 dup(?)errmsg db Incorrect input!,0dh,0ah,$yesmsg db Yes!It is a prime.,0dh,0ah,$nomsg db No!It is not a pr

2004-10-29 14:55:00 1498

原创 画椭圆的汇编程序,是上学期微机课上写的

还去翻了翻图形学的书才知道这算法的-_-b .486data segment use16t dw ?a dw ?b dw ?d1 dd ?d2 dd ?xc dw ?yc dw ?x dw ?y dw ?taa dd ?t2aa dd ?t4aa dd ?tbb dd ?t2bb dd ?t4bb dd ?t2abb dd ?t2bbx dd ?tx dw ?mode equ 012hcolo

2004-10-29 14:54:00 1008

原创 阿菲连连看1.0Beta released

总算可以发布了,从无聊的国庆开始,到现在,共2个星期,虽然不是天天敲代码,也不是一敲就8个小时,但也把我弄得形容憔悴,快心力交瘁了-_-b第一次铆足了劲做这样的程序。很多新的尝试,比如STL,比如用iostream操作文件,比如VCL的图形操作。STL真是个好东东,可以省下不少时间和精力,而且代码高效又健壮,这是我最喜欢的原因之一,因为一开始选择什么C/C++就是看重了它高效的特点。以前一

2004-10-29 14:52:00 866

原创 LLYF TelTelHelper WIP

armored找来一个免费打电话的东东,可以PC2PC,还可以PC2Phone,而且还支持到一些欧美国家。东西是好,不过一个最大的缺点是很难拨通,armored说要锲而不舍,不停地重拨,还找了个自动拨号工具,不过说要注册,不然只能用6次就没有了。于是我就想自己写一个好了。拿出我最熟悉的Borland C++Builder6,看了一下TelTel的拨号主界面,先用MiniSpy查看了一下上面的几

2004-10-29 14:51:00 676

原创 LLYF AddressBook WIP

白天在无所事事,没做自己的事。晚上的时候花了几分钟,改进了一下LLYF AddressBook的用户界面。其实也就是把打开的mdb中包含的表,全部名称从原来的一个ListBox中转移到一个ComboBox中,然后能把所有字段的名称添加到另一个ComboBox中,这个查询操作就可以对每个拥有不同字段的表进行了,还可以指定每个字段的查询操作是否要求模糊查询。

2004-10-29 14:50:00 662

原创 LLYF IPKeeper completed

经过今天上午和下午的努力,终于可以算是把LLYF IPKeeper弄好了,可以放出第一个release版本了。上午把程序的界面做好,以及一些常用的功能,周边细节,比如本地IP、物理地址,随系统启动,托盘图标,中文化等。下午做了剩下的一些事情,单一实例运行,消息框屏蔽,holyzzd说也要一个试试,于是我就给她的那个Copy里加了IP限制,免得我到时候传到E383上去后,引起大面积传播,就泛

2004-10-29 14:48:00 957 2

原创 LLYF IPKeeper WIP

昨天断电前的最后一个多小时里,总结了前几天对Win2000的事件查看器以及相关Win32API的研究,用Borland C++ Builder6写一个反冲IP的小程序。本来是希望能让程序在后台运行,每当系统被冲IP时,就会写相应的事件到System日志中,这个时候能自动通知我的程序,这是最好的办法,但是研究了几天,觉得这些API还是难用了一点,在网上也查了一些资料,好像有一种叫“日志钩子”的东

2004-10-29 14:47:00 644

原创 w3l.exe逆向之自写程序篇

既然把反汇编代码都读了一遍了,就可以自己来写一个同样功能的程序了。这里用C写一个,在Win2000下的VC7.1和GCC3.4下都通过的,功能也完成的(可以连上PvPGN的),但是DOS下的TC、BC是不行的,因为这要调用到Windows的API。程序很简单,从反汇编代码里都可以看出这一点,呵呵。代码如下:#include #include #include int WinMain(       

2004-10-29 14:42:00 1100

原创 Fterm附带IP数据库的修改

Fterm所附带的IP数据都存放在一个叫QQWry.dat的文件里面,因为学校里的校园网比较发达,几乎每个想上校园网的人都得拥有一个独立的IP,所以就有为学校的IP做记录的想法。为了修改Fterm里的IP数据库,先找到一个叫“QQIP数据编辑器”的程序,好像QQ2004精灵坊显IP版15.0永久珍藏版里就附带了这个程序,文件名是QQIP.exe,用这个程序,可以打开QQWry.dat文件,并将其转

2004-10-29 14:42:00 2102

原创 w3l.exe逆向之反汇编代码分析篇

得到了反汇编代码,就可以看到程序是如何运作的。用IDA Pro 4.5装入已经脱了壳的w3l.exe,经过IDA的一番咀嚼,会得到排版比较好看的代码:loc_401000:                             ; CODE XREF: foo.:0040109Aj                                        ; foo.:004010ABj

2004-10-29 14:41:00 2236

原创 w3l.exe逆向之脱壳篇

TFT在连PvPGN架的战网时,要用特定的Loader来载入启动,那Loader也就2个文件,一个是w3l.exe,另一个是w3lh.dll,每次都是通过运行w3l.exe来启动正常的魔兽。由于觉得好奇,所以这次把w3l.exe肢解了看看。基本需求:知道80x86汇编,会一点C,了解Windows程序设计基本原理,最好还有MSDN随时备查。先用PEiD看了看w3l.exe(这是用于1.14-1.1

2004-10-29 14:36:00 2995

原创 帮一个MM弄文档的经历

帮了个MM写程序,写了程序还要写文档于是我先用Word2003写了个文档,为了表达清楚,所以插了几幅图(这是引发问题的原因)欢天喜地传给她,结果说是打开了是乱码~~~问了一下她装的是Office2000,于是想乱码是情有可缘的,我的Office2003没打兼容性补丁不想打补丁了,看了一下AdobeAcrobat在Word2003里的插件按钮,哈哈马上转成.pdf的,再传然后再教她上E383装Ado

2004-10-29 14:33:00 1251

原创 版聚流水账

前言:版聚了几天了,一直忙于“堕落”,连写篇纪实的时间都忘记抽出来,真的xx,昨天下午就想过的,结果到了晚上熄灯的还是荒废了,于是只好今天早上,趁着被军训的DDMM们吵醒的机会,来记一下流水账^_^ 版聚说起来已经是上个星期六晚上的事情了,说是Software和Windows联合,我作为Software的常客外加Windows和版主,当然要去啦,其实只是觉得那帮家伙应该很好玩才去的-_-b

2004-10-29 14:32:00 656 1

Luabind 使用手册 中文版 高清PDF v0.9.1

Luabind 使用手册(http://www.rasterbar.com/products/luabind/docs.html) 中文版 高清PDF 一年前传过一个当时Luabind版本才0.8,后来出了0.9.1,今天有空了就更新了一下。有些语句意思是懂了,但却不知道怎么用中文表达,可能不好理解。

2010-11-27

编译器内存分配性能测试

MSVC2008、Intel C++ 11.0.061、Open Watcom 1.8、Borland C++ 5.5、Borland C++ 6.21、MinGW GCC 4.4.0、Digital Mars C/C++ 8.51内存分配性能测试

2010-02-06

编译器内存分配性能测试

MSVC2008、Intel C++ 11.0.061、Open Watcom 1.8、Borland C++ 5.5、MinGW GCC 4.4.0、Digital Mars C/C++ 8.51内存分配性能测试

2010-02-05

LLYF ToolBox

LLYF ToolBox作为一款Windows程序员辅助工具集,包含了6个工具,分别是LLYF Spy、LLYF ProcessHelper、LLYF IconHelper、LLYF DebugCapture、LLYF DirectService、LLYF MD5Checker。虽然这次发布的LLYF ToolBox的版本号为1.0,但里面独立的工具有的已经经过好好几个版本的发展,这次是作为几款工具集合发布的第一个版本。    LLYF Spy是一种Windows窗口类观察器,可算是Spy++的强力补充。小巧易用,功能强大。可以随便抓捕任何可见的Windows窗口类,并获取各种窗口类信息,还可以抓取常见Windows窗口内包含的内容,可以查看窗口类包含关系和窗口类风格,可以抓取窗口的图像,可以捕获窗口接收到的 Windows消息,还可以深入查看IE浏览器显示的网页信息,甚至可以捕捉任何其它程序用OutputDebugString输出的信息。同时LLYF Spy提供了插件机制,任何人都可以为其编写插件,扩展其功能。    LLYF ProcessHelper是一个增强型的Windows进程管理器。不但可以查看所有的进程名,还可以查看到进程对应的启动命令行、占用的CPU时间、占用的内存数量、优先级、包含的程序模块、内存映射文件、线程。另外,还可以查看系统中的服务列表、驱动程序列表以及BHO。    LLYF IconHelper是个图标抓取工具。可以从任意文件中试图提取图标,并以1位色、2位色、4位色、8位色或24位色保存。它提供了各种方便的图标浏览和提取功能。甚至可以一次到某个文件夹下包括子文件夹下所有的文件中包含的图标都提取出来。    LLYF DebugCapture用来捕获系统中其它进程用OutputDebugString输出的信息。相比LLYF Spy中提供的功能,它提供了更多有用的功能。    LLYF DirectService用来操作Windows中的服务,它与LLYF ProcessHelper中的提供的服务列表功能是互补的,同时也更轻巧方便。    LLYF MD5Checker,可用于计算文件,或字符串的MD5值。对于大文件,计算速度相当快,而且支持拖拽功能。    最后要提到的是,LLYF ToolBox是完全免费的。

2006-11-19

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除